Things To Do In Torres del Rio
Torres del Rio is a small village located in the region of Navarre, Spain. Despite its size, there are several things to do in Torres del Rio that can make your visit worthwhile.
One of the main attractions in Torres del Rio is the Church of the Holy Sepulchre. This Romanesque church dates back to the 12th century and is known for its unique octagonal shape. Inside, you can admire beautiful frescoes and sculptures that depict scenes from the Bible.
Another highlight in Torres del Rio is the Camino de Santiago, also known as the Way of St. James. This famous pilgrimage route passes through the village, and many hikers and pilgrims stop here to rest and explore. You can take a leisurely walk along the Camino, enjoying the picturesque landscapes and the peaceful atmosphere.
If you're interested in history, you can visit the ruins of the Castle of Torres del Rio. Although only a few walls remain, it offers a glimpse into the village's medieval past. From the top of the castle, you can enjoy panoramic views of the surrounding countryside.
For nature lovers, a visit to the nearby Bardenas Reales Natural Park is a must. This unique desert-like landscape is characterized by its eroded cliffs, canyons, and unusual rock formations. You can go hiking or cycling through the park, or simply take in the breathtaking views.

Best Time To Visit Torres del Rio
The best time to visit Torres del Rio is during the spring and fall seasons. During these times, the weather is mild and pleasant, making it ideal for exploring the town and its surroundings. The summer months can be hot and crowded, as it is a popular tourist destination. Winter can be cold and rainy, which may limit outdoor activities. Therefore, spring and fall offer the perfect balance of comfortable weather and fewer crowds, allowing visitors to fully enjoy their experience in Torres del Rio.

Transportation To Torres del Rio
There are several transportation options to Torres del Rio:
1. By car: You can drive to Torres del Rio using the local road network. The village is located in the region of Navarre, Spain, and can be accessed via the NA-1110 road.
2. By bus: There are bus services available from nearby towns and cities to Torres del Rio. You can check the local bus schedules and book tickets accordingly.
3. By train: The nearest train station to Torres del Rio is in Logrono, which is approximately 30 kilometers away. From Logrono, you can take a taxi or a bus to reach Torres del Rio.
4. By taxi: You can hire a taxi from nearby towns or cities to reach Torres del Rio. This option provides flexibility and convenience, but it can be more expensive compared to other modes of transportation.
5. By walking or cycling: If you are in the vicinity, you can also consider walking or cycling to Torres del Rio. The village is located in a picturesque rural area, and this can be a great way to enjoy the scenery while reaching your destination.

Nearby Destination From Torres del Rio
1. Logrono: A vibrant city known for its wine and tapas culture.
2. Estella: A charming medieval town with a rich history and beautiful architecture.
3. Puente la Reina: A picturesque village famous for its medieval bridge and Camino de Santiago pilgrimage route.
4. Los Arcos: A small town with a well-preserved historic center and a popular stop along the Camino de Santiago.
5. Viana: A fortified town with a stunning castle and a lively atmosphere.
6. Laguardia: A medieval village surrounded by vineyards, offering excellent wine tasting experiences.
7. Santo Domingo de la Calzada: A pilgrimage town with a fascinating cathedral and a unique tradition involving a live rooster.
8. San Millan de la Cogolla: A UNESCO World Heritage site known for its monasteries and as the birthplace of the Spanish language.
9. Najera: A historic town with a beautiful monastery and a rich cultural heritage.
10. Calahorra: A city with Roman origins, famous for its archaeological sites and delicious vegetables.
